Terms Comparison: What Actually Decides Your Value
Headline bonus figures look attractive, but the terms beneath them determine real value. Wagering requirements across these five operators range from 25x to 45x — all within the typical 20x to 65x band that MGA and UKGC operators set as commercial terms. A £50 bonus at 35x wagering requires £1,750 in turnover before you can withdraw winnings, so a lower multiplier matters more than a flashier bonus amount.

Terms Glossary: Decoding the Fine Print
Understanding the jargon below will save you from unpleasant surprises when you claim a bonus.
| Term | Plain-English Meaning | Practical Note |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| How many times you must bet the bonus before withdrawing | Lower is better; 25x beats 45x every time |
| Game weighting | What percentage of each bet counts toward wagering | Slots usually count 100%, table games often just 10% |
| Max bet | The largest single stake allowed while a bonus is active | Exceeding it voids the bonus and any winnings |
| Payout cap | The maximum you can withdraw from bonus winnings | A £500 cap on a £100 bonus limits your upside |
| Sticky bonus | A bonus you cannot withdraw, only the winnings from it | Check whether the bonus amount is deducted from your withdrawal |
One term deserves special attention: game weighting. A 30x wagering requirement sounds manageable, but if table games only contribute 10% toward it, you would need to bet ten times more to clear it. Always check the weighting table before you play anything other than slots.

Why do payout times vary so much between operators?
Because each casino runs its own internal approval process before releasing funds. Some verify documents automatically, while others manually review every withdrawal request. E-wallet payouts are fastest because they bypass banking intermediaries, but the casino’s own processing speed is the dominant factor.
